Ultraviolet Radiation

Ultraviolet radiation is a electromagnetic radiation that affects all living organism with diverse effects, depending on its different wavelengths—with no immediate reaction and invisible in its content. The UV radiation statistics show that sun exposure and its ultraviolet radiation rays are the main cause of non-melanoma skin cancer and melanoma. The latest studies show that children with serious sunburns will develop skin cancer in about 20 years or more, with the UV radiation sources mainly listed as through the sun UV radiation, with the hole in the ozone layer allowing most of its ultraviolet radiation in. The amount of sunlight with the rays coming into the atmosphere depend on a location’s latitude and elevation, cloud cover, precautionary behavior, time of outdoor exposure and how long it lasts, and closeness to an industrial area. In addition, a person’s age and skin color will influence the occurring cancer and effects of the radiation.

The effects of ultraviolet radiation, especially the UV-B radiation, seem to be focusing on the skin, eyes, and immune system. Most effects of UV radiation on the environment and people are from about a 0.5% UV-B radiant energy, and are responsible for most of the effects on us. That is what causes most of the sunburns and tanning, skin vitamin D3, snow blindness, cataracts, and heavily influences the immune system. Once this happens, our body’s repair system heavily goes into action, both for the DNA molecule and the body’s primary reactions. The health effects of UV radiation vary with many areas considered, but still safety steps for UV radiation should always be in effects as it is dangerous, with the cause of ultraviolet radiation mainly the sun.

The types and sources of UV radiation, referring to ultraviolet radiation and fluorescence, are not just from the sun even though it is the largest source. Other sources are man-made, such as UV lamps, arc welding, and mercury vapor lamps. It is also used in industrial processes, along with medical and dental areas—the thing to remember is that different UV intensities, and wavelengths, allow it to be accessible in different areas and for different purposes.
